Ticket: PUB-1187 — misconfigured environment broke pagination on the Lanternfish public REST API. Staging was serving unbounded page sizes because PAGE_SIZE_MAX was unset, falling back to zero, which the handler treats as unlimited. This allowed full-table dumps through a single request, which is the security concern here. Fix: set PAGE_SIZE_MAX=100 and add a startup check that refuses to boot when it is absent. The rate-limiter that enforces this also needs its signing secret, appended directly below this line.

vault entry, yahaf-tagug: LEDGER_TOKEN20=884d77d1a8b98aa4edfb

## v2.4.1 — Reminder Job Fixes

Quick one for support: the Cliniqa appointment reminder job no longer double-sends texts when a patient reschedules within the same hour. We also fixed the timezone hiccup that sent a few 5 a.m. reminders to folks in the Westmere region — sorry about those tickets! Retries now back off properly instead of hammering the gateway. If anything still looks weird in the reminder queue, escalate to the release owner named below.

account owner for bawip-tahag: Raleth Quenok

Meeting Notes (excerpt) — Permit Blueprints, Calderfen Annex

Attendees agreed the stamped blueprints for the Calderfen Annex building permit must travel as one sealed tube, never folded. Driver to be briefed by the coordinator personally; the municipal office at Harrowgate Square accepts documents only before 15:00. The following hand-over instruction applies to the courier:

handover note for yagef-bagep: the drudor pelius courier leaves the kasdor zorvan norir ledger at gate 8016 under passcode 755406

When two clients modify the same event window, the Tidecal sync engine marks the record as conflicted and stops propagating changes until a resolution is posted to the /conflicts endpoint. On-call engineers should resolve conflicts by submitting the winning revision ID; the losing revision is archived, not deleted, and can be restored for 30 days. All conflict-resolution calls go through the internal Tidecal arbiter, authenticated with the key below.

gateway credential: kto3_qfe